Which statements describe a good hypothesis? Check all that apply.

A hypothesis is defined as a tentative or proposed explanation for the occurrence of any phenomenon.

It is usually based on a very less number of pieces of evidence and provides the first step for further classification.

The hypothesis must be testable so that it can be accepted or rejected on the basis of scientific methods.

compare Boerne v. Flores to Marbury v. Madison. Which power was used by the Supreme Court in each case? How were the Supreme Cou
GalinKa [24]
<span>Flores is an example of judicial review, which was created in Madison. The court can use cases such as Boerne to determine the constitutionality of laws passed by Congress. In Marbury, the Court ruled that Congress had overstepped its constitutional powers with the Judiciary Act of 1789. In Boerne, the Court again ruled that Congress overstepped its powers. Congress must abide by the principle of limited government, and it must respect separation of powers.   </span>
